Beverley Visitor Centre

The Beverley Visitor Centre is located in the heart of town.

The Visitor Centre stocks an array of Beverley mementoes, gifts, fresh coffee beans and many locally-made products.

There is a wonderful interactive aeronautical exhibit, complete with a 1:5 scale model, replica of the silver centenary plane built in Beverley. The Silver Centenary is a biplane that was built in Beverley between 1929 and 1930 by a local named Selby Ford.
